Summary: | Surface phenomena are often at the origin of interconnection problems and it is necessary to study them with suitable analytical techniques. Auger electron spectroscopy (AES) is used here to establish the cause of observed failures at different levels of electronic interconnection. Failures are related to contamination: the most frequently encountered contaminants are carbonaceous compounds. It is suggested that manufacturing processes are the principal cause of such contaminants. |
